I am hoping I can get some BH opinion on where my wife and I are at financially with the goal of myself retiring in 10 years and my wife continuing to work, but likely scaling back at that time. We have a unique situation
I am 54, she is 37 and we have 2 kids - 1 and 3. Yes I am a late bloomer and still active and young and loving bein an older dad thus far! with her age, we need to make sure the retirement funds are not depleted once I am taking a dirt nap
I have some individual stocks but strictly VTSAX at this point is where I am putting my money.
My risk tolerance is pretty high - we are 100% stocks right now
Income: ( Both in tech sales, fairly established but our income can flex) 2023 was 995k, we should be consistently in the 700-900k range
me - 500-700k , her 200 - 400k
taxable: 1.4m (combined)
my 401k - 500k
her Roth 401k - 300k
Eth/BC - 100k
Rental Income: 5500/mo ( 750k in equity, I plan to keep this as rental income in retirement as we are in a healthy rental market, Scottsdale, AZ ) mortgage will be paid off in 2035)
SS at 67 - 3900/mo or so
Current Mortgage : 7000/mo, (1m mortg, 28 yrs left -
529 - both boys should be good by 18 with relatives pitching in and we are contributing 500/mo for each at the moment.
We are saving at about 20% right now and investing into VTSAX - 401k and taxable
Estimated expenses/mo in retirement - 15-20k, I am struggling to pin this number down as we are unsure how long she will work past my retirement date.
I have run the numbers some and 5m is my goal at the moment, and with her working past my retirement date we should have pretty good income cushion to not have to withdraw as much from our accounts initially.
